X 
微信扫码联系客服
获取报价、解决方案


李经理
15150181012
首页 > 知识库 > 统一消息平台> 统一消息服务与网页版解决方案
统一消息平台在线试用
统一消息平台
在线试用
统一消息平台解决方案
统一消息平台
解决方案下载
统一消息平台源码
统一消息平台
源码授权
统一消息平台报价
统一消息平台
产品报价

统一消息服务与网页版解决方案

2025-01-31 06:06

在现代网络应用中,统一消息服务(Unified Message Service)和网页版(Web Version)是两个重要的组成部分。为了提供一个高效、可靠且易于维护的应用系统,我们提出了以下解决方案。

师生综合服务门户

### 统一消息服务架构

统一消息服务的核心在于将多种消息渠道整合到一个平台中,包括电子邮件、短信、即时消息等。这可以通过使用消息队列(Message Queue)来实现。以下是使用RabbitMQ作为消息队列的一个示例代码:

import pika
def send_message(message):
connection = pika.BlockingConnection(pika.ConnectionParameters('localhost'))
channel = connection.channel()
channel.queue_declare(queue='message_queue')
channel.basic_publish(exchange='',
routing_key='message_queue',
body=message)
connection.close()
send_message("Hello, this is a test message.")

### 网页版集成

网页版则是用户通过浏览器访问应用程序的主要入口。为了确保用户体验的一致性和性能,我们可以使用React框架进行前端开发,并利用Webpack进行模块打包。以下是创建一个简单的React组件的示例代码:

统一消息服务

import React from 'react';
class MessageComponent extends React.Component {
render() {
return (
Welcome to the Unified Message Service Web Version This is a sample message component.
); } } export default MessageComponent;

### 结论

通过上述代码示例,我们可以看到如何在统一消息服务和网页版之间建立有效的连接。这种解决方案不仅提高了系统的可扩展性,还增强了用户体验。

]]>

本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!